华为云个人服务器设置
华为云个人服务器设置全攻略
随着云计算技术的不断完善,个人服务器的选择早已不再局限于传统自建物理机房。国产云服务品牌华为云凭借其高稳定性、低成本优势,逐渐成为用户搭建私人服务器的首选。本文将带你了解如何从零开始设置华为云个人服务器,结合实际应用场景解析关键操作,帮你打造专属的云空间。
一、华为云个人服务器的适用场景解析
1.1 网站搭建与托管
无论是静态博客、动态页面开发还是API接口测试,华为云提供的一键部署功能可快速完成LNMP/LEMP环境配置。不同规格的云服务器实例(如bms/bn系列)可灵活适配低流量小站或高并发应用。
1.2 开发测试实验室
通过镜像市场的多样化选择,开发者能够快速构建包含Docker环境、Kubernetes集群的测试平台。配合弹性IP与快照功能,实现测试环境的快速启动与销毁。
1.3 个人数据存储中心
设置NFS共享文件系统或使用S3对象存储接口,可轻松构建分布式存储方案。结合华为云的HTTP服务,打造带访问权限管理的个人网盘系统。
二、三步构建个人服务器环境
2.1 服务器部署阶段
- 账户创建与认证:先完成华为云账户实名认证,获取300元新用户启动礼包
- 实例选型技巧:基础应用推荐单核1G内存的入门级配置,建议优先选择SSD云硬盘
- 网络架构设计:为不同服务划分VPC虚拟私有网络,通过子网隔离确保数据安全
2.2 系统配置实践
- 登录云服务器后建立标准用户,禁用root直接登录(步骤参考如下):
- 创建新用户并设置密码
- 修改SSH配置文件
/etc/ssh/sshd_config
- 设置端口白名单与登录日志保存时间
- 安装常规安全组件:
- 部署iptables防火墙规则
- 安装ClamAV反病毒系统
- 启用SSH密钥认证机制
- 配置环境依赖:
- 安装Nginx/Apache等Web服务
- 配置MySQL/MongoDB数据库
- 安装PM2等进程管理工具
2.3 深度功能拓展
通过华为云弹性伸缩功能,可设置服务器负载阈值后自动扩容。结合CDN加速网络,实现博客资源加载速度提升40%以上。对于物联网项目,借助华为云IoT平台接口可快速完成设备数据中转设置。
三、典型操作场景详解
3.1 远程连接配置
- 使用华为云免密码登录方式时,需在本地生成密钥对并上传公钥
- 当启用双因素认证后,建议配置SSH端口转发确保远程办公不受局域网限制
- 对外提供服务时,可设置反向代理实现域名映射,应用访问入口建议配置HTTPS证书
3.2 文件同步方案
- 基础版:使用rsync工具按定时任务同步本地/服务器文件
- 进阶版:整合华为云OBS对象存储,创建存储桶并设置访问策略
- 终极版:部署Syncthing+WebDAV组合,实现多设备间双向实时同步
3.3 安全防护策略
- 为服务器设置独立安全组,按需开启80/443/22等必要端口
- 部署fail2ban防火墙工具,自动拦截异常登录行为
- 在系统日志输出中,建议为关键服务配置专属日志分割规则
四、优化使用效能的5个技巧
4.1 网络加速技巧
通过华为云的增强型负载均衡器,可使静态资源响应时间缩短30%。针对海外用户访问,建议启用GeoIP重定向功能。
4.2 GPU加速解决方案
游戏服务器、深度学习项目可选择gpu.n1.4*规格实例。安装显卡驱动后,测试显示PyTorch运行效率提升2.1倍。
4.3 多实例联动配置
建立服务器集群时,可运用华为云无状态Pod模式。建议为每个服务组件分配独立弹性IP,便于后续扩容维护。
4.4 日常维护建议
- 制定3-4轮数据快照策略:每日全量备份+每周增量备份
- 保持系统更新但避免全量升级:使用
unattended-upgrades
设置定向更新 - 配置监控告警:为CPU/内存/Kms服务设置阈值通知
4.5 故障排查流程
当出现"502 Bad Gateway"时,依次检查:Nginx报错日志→后端服务状态→安全组配置。若遭遇异地登录攻击,优先执行:
- 立即更改root密码
- 关闭不必要服务
- 更新iptables封锁策略
五、费用控制与资源管理
5.1 计费模型解析
华为云提供"包月+按需"混合计费模式,建议通过定时关机脚本管理闲置实例。使用2核4G配置时,每月耗电量可降低48%。
5.2 资源监控仪表盘
实战经验表明,将CPU利用率报警阈值设为70%可有效预防性能瓶颈。配置监控面板时可同时跟踪:
- 内存使用峰值
- 网络流入流出带宽
- 磁盘IO吞吐量
5.3 弹性扩容实践
当MySQL出现时不时的超时问题时,可分别尝试:
- 升级实例磁盘至SSD
- 增加内网数据库连接数
- 启用主从复制架构
六、新手常见误区与解决方案
- 误操作风险:某用户直接在生产环境运行磁盘格式化命令,通过快照迅速恢复。建议在命令前加
echo
进行dry run验证。 - 网络安全意识:曾有案例显示未配置安全组导致Mirai僵尸网络攻击,防御方案应包含关闭ICMP回包响应。
- 资源释放问题:释放实例时需同步解除弹性IP绑定,否则会产生持续的公网IP租赁费用。
七、进阶应用场景开发
针对需更高稳定性的用户,可尝试:
- 使用华为云的弹性IP+SLB实现双活架构
- 配置MySQL集群提高数据库安全性
- 搭建LVS负载均衡节点提升处理能力
对于AIGC应用开发,实战测试显示调用华为云ModelArts接口,在GPU服务器上部署Stable Diffusion需额外安装xorg-x11-drv-nvidia
驱动。具体流程为:
- 创建GPU型实例
- 安装驱动并生效
- 配置CUDA兼容性
- 环境测试验证
八、稳定性保护措施
- 电力保障:华为云数据中心采用2N冗余供电,但建议当地工行联合储备UPS后备电源
- 自动续费设置:为防止欠费停机,应配置自动充值账户并设置余额预警
- 灾备方案:生产环境中应建立跨区域3副本存储策略,数据同步间隔建议控制在5秒以内
九、技术社区资源整合
华为云设有专门的技术支持论坛,实测反馈近期新增的:
- 零点播报系统:自动推送AI运行报告
- 代码托管插件:支持Git/Gerrit版本控制
- 部署流水线工具:集成CI/CD自动化流程
总结
从基础环境搭建到深度功能拓展,华为云个人服务器的设置过程需要兼顾稳定性与成本控制。通过合理规划资源、设置多重防御机制、结合华为云生态工具,可让个人服务器的运行效率提升3倍以上。建议根据实际应用需求分阶段升级配置,前期保持单服务单实例的简洁架构,待业务增长后再逐步扩展。